Why Influencer Marketing Works: The Psychology Behind the Trend
The effectiveness of influencer marketing can be linked to the emotional relationship that social media stars have with their subscribers. Unlike standard promotions, which often feel annoying, influencer campaigns feels authentic and tailored. This feeling of authenticity is what makes influencer marketing so compelling.
When an influencer recommends a brand, their audience are more likely to believe their opinion because they view the influencer as a mentor rather than a business. This degree of trust is hard to accomplish through conventional advertising. Additionally, influencer marketing utilizes the strength of social proof, as consumers are more likely to invest in a item if they see others recommending it.
Choosing the Right Influencer for Your Brand
Selecting the ideal influencer is crucial to the performance of your strategy. While celebrity influencers may have a enormous audience, they may not always be the optimal option for your company. Mid-tier creators, on the other hand, often have a smaller community that is highly relevant to your niche.
When evaluating potential influencers, consider factors such as audience participation, post aesthetics, and brand alignment. It's also essential to examine the influencer's credibility and ensure they have a record of authentic partnerships. By partnering with an influencer who aligns with your mission, you can build a campaign that feels organic and appeals with your intended demographic.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Influencer Marketing
While influencer marketing can be extremely successful, it's not without its pitfalls. Typical errors such as partnering with the wrong influencer, overlooking to set specific targets, and disregarding audience input can jeopardize the success of your strategy.
To minimize these mistakes, it's essential to carry out thorough analysis before initiating your campaign. Establish measurable targets and communicate them transparently with your creator. Additionally, monitor the success of your initiative and make adjustments as required to guarantee its performance.
